About

Taher Hajilounezhad is a scholar working on Materials Chemistry, Atomic and Molecular Physics, and Optics and Mechanical Engineering. According to data from OpenAlex, Taher Hajilounezhad has authored 11 papers receiving a total of 291 indexed citations (citations by other indexed papers that have themselves been cited), including 6 papers in Materials Chemistry, 4 papers in Atomic and Molecular Physics, and Optics and 2 papers in Mechanical Engineering. Recurrent topics in Taher Hajilounezhad’s work include Carbon Nanotubes in Composites (5 papers), Force Microscopy Techniques and Applications (3 papers) and Graphene research and applications (2 papers). Taher Hajilounezhad is often cited by papers focused on Carbon Nanotubes in Composites (5 papers), Force Microscopy Techniques and Applications (3 papers) and Graphene research and applications (2 papers). Taher Hajilounezhad collaborates with scholars based in United States, Iran and India. Taher Hajilounezhad's co-authors include M.A. Ehyaei, Sadegh Safari, Matthew R. Maschmann, Abolfazl Ahmadi, Hossein Abbaspour, Mamdouh El Haj Assad, Abir Hmida, Stéphane Abanades, Farbod Esmaeilion and Mohammad Al‐Shabi and has published in prestigious journals such as Carbon, ACS Applied Materials & Interfaces and IEEE Access.
